高级数据库课程课件(EN)
《高级数据库课程课件》是浙江大学提供的一套深入解析数据库技术的教育资源,旨在帮助学习者掌握数据库的深层次机制,从而能够更高效地开发和优化数据库应用程序。这些课件覆盖了数据库领域的多个关键主题,包括数据挖掘、并行处理、信息检索、网页搜索、数据库系统介绍、决策支持、存储结构、XML处理、索引技术和空间数据处理。 L1_Intro.pdf 提供了数据库系统的概述,介绍了数据库的基本概念、历史发展以及在现代信息技术中的重要地位。这部分内容将帮助初学者建立对数据库系统的整体认识,并理解其在各种应用中的核心作用。 L2_Storage.pdf 专注于数据库的存储结构,涵盖了关系数据库的内部组织方式,如B树、B+树等索引结构,以及数据页、缓冲池等内存管理机制。这部分内容是理解和优化数据库性能的关键,因为它直接影响到数据的读写速度。 L3_Indexes.pdf 进一步探讨了数据库索引的原理与实现,包括不同类型的索引(如唯一索引、聚集索引和非聚集索引)及其优缺点,以及如何根据查询需求选择合适的索引策略。索引对于提高查询效率至关重要,是数据库设计中的重要环节。 L4_Spatial.pdf 关注的是空间数据处理,讲解了如何存储和操作地理信息,包括空间数据模型、空间查询和空间分析。这一领域在地理信息系统、城市规划、交通管理等领域有着广泛应用。 L5_IR.pdf 讲解信息检索,涵盖了文本索引、倒排索引、TF-IDF等相关概念,这些都是搜索引擎和信息检索系统的核心技术。通过理解这些内容,开发者可以构建更高效的文本搜索功能。 L6-Websearch.pdf 专门讨论网页搜索,涉及到网页爬虫、网页排名算法(如PageRank)、链接分析等互联网搜索引擎的关键技术。这有助于我们理解Google等大型搜索引擎的工作原理。 L7_Parallel.pdf 介绍了数据库的并行处理,讲述了如何在多处理器或分布式环境下并行执行SQL查询,以提高大数据处理能力。并行计算是大数据时代数据库性能提升的重要手段。 L8_Decision.pdf 聚焦于决策支持系统,讲述了如何利用数据库技术进行数据分析和商业智能,包括OLAP(在线分析处理)、数据仓库等概念,为决策制定提供有力支持。 L9_XML.pdf 讲述XML这种重要的数据交换格式,包括XML的语法、解析与验证,以及XML与数据库的集成。XML广泛用于跨平台的数据交换和存储,了解其在数据库中的应用对现代信息系统开发非常重要。 L10_DataMining.pdf 最后是关于数据挖掘的内容,介绍了从大量数据中发现模式和知识的方法,包括聚类、分类、关联规则等技术,这是大数据分析和人工智能的基础。 通过学习这些课件,不仅可以深入理解数据库系统的核心机制,还能掌握如何设计和优化高效的数据存储、检索和分析解决方案,这对于任何涉及数据库开发和管理的专业人士来说都是宝贵的资源。
- 1
- 粉丝: 1
- 资源: 6
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
评论1